Questions & Answers
Q: How is Apollo Global Management involved in the digital asset space?
Apollo Global Management is a half-a-trillion-dollar alternative asset manager that is actively investing in digital assets and using blockchain technology to put real-world assets on the blockchain.
Q: What is the goal of LMAX Group in launching Futures Trading for cryptocurrencies?
LMAX Group aims to build an institutional ecosystem by providing trading services for both spot and futures contracts, targeting both banks and non-banks in the crypto market.
Q: How do institutions perceive the current crypto market?
The crypto market's recent downturn has made some institutions cautious, but others see it as a great entry point for investing in the industry.
Q: What role does regulation play in institutional adoption of crypto?
Regulatory clarity and guidelines are crucial for institutional investors to enter the crypto market. The lack of regulatory determination hinders institutional adoption and raises concerns about investor protection.
Summary & Key Takeaways
-
Apollo Global Management is entering the digital asset space as both a real-world practitioner and investor, aiming to make their investments more successful by leveraging their cross-asset markets expertise.
-
LMAX Group operates six exchanges globally and recently launched Futures Trading for six different cryptocurrencies, with the aim of building an institutional ecosystem.
-
Institutions are facing challenges in entering the crypto market due to regulatory uncertainties, but the development of clear regulations could attract institutional investors.
